RE: The tariff classification of a Unisex Nylon Woven Ski Suit from China

Dear Ms. Burns:

In your letter dated May 4, 1999, you requested a tariff classification ruling on behalf of Kid Cool of North America, Inc., 1674 Alton Road, Suite 500, Miami Beach, Florida.

The sample submitted, Style Number K316809, is a unisex ski suit designed for children, and constructed from 100% woven nylon fabric with a 100% polyester filling. This garment features a partial zippered front closure that extends to the top of the 2 3/4 inch stand-up collar. A placket with four Velcro closures covers the zipper. The long sleeves have elastic tightening at the wrist. Two zippered pockets are placed in the chest area above the one inch clasp belt. Two additional zippered pockets are placed at the hip area. Zippers are also placed on the outside of each hemmed leg. When opened, they reveal a leg sleeve with elastic tightening at the ankle. Kid Cool logos are sewn onto the left front chest area and left sleeve. The words Kid Cool Ski are embroidered onto the back of the stand up collar. You state the ski suit will be imported in sizes S, M, L, & XL. The sample you provided will be returned to you as requested.

The applicable subheading for the 100% Nylon Woven Ski Suit for children will be 6211.20.7820,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States(HTS), which provides for Track Suits, ski-suits and swimwear; other garments: Ski-suits: Other: Other: Womens or girls: Other: Other: Of man-made fibers. The rate of duty will be 16%.

The Unisex Nylon Ski Suit for children falls within textile category designation 659. Based upon international textile trade agreements, products of China are subject to quota and the requirement of a visa.

The designated textile and apparel categories may be subdivided into parts. If so, visa and quota requirements applicable to the subject merchandise may be affected. Part categories are the result of international bilateral agreements which are subject to frequent renegotiations and changes. To obtain the most current information available, we suggest that you check, close to the time of shipment, the Status Report on Current Import Quotas (Restraint Levels), an internal issuance of the U.S. Customs Service, which is available for inspection at your local Customs office.
